Lightning Protection in Coal Mines and Lightning Warning System

Due to the special mining environment, coal mines have large amounts of flammable and explosive gases/dust underground, and numerous large electrical equipment and communication systems arranged on the surface. When lightning occurs, the powerful lightning current generates electromagnetic pulses that may damage electrical equipment, cause system paralysis, and trigger power outages. Moreover, the generated sparks may ignite combustible substances underground, leading to serious disasters such as gas explosions and fires, threatening miners' lives and causing huge economic losses. Therefore, lightning protection in coal mines is a critical link to ensure safe production.
To effectively address lightning threats, regulations require coal mines to install a Lightning Warning System.
The Lightning Warning System FT-LD1 is a monitoring device that real-time monitors changes in atmospheric electric fields. It consists of multiple key components: an electric field detection sensor, a data acquisition and processing unit, and a warning release module.
The electric field detection sensor detects subtle fluctuations in the surrounding atmospheric electric field. When a thunderstorm cloud approaches, the electric field intensity changes significantly, and the sensor captures these changes in a timely manner, transmitting signals to the data acquisition and processing unit.
This unit receives signals from the sensor. By comparing real-time data with lightning occurrence thresholds, the system judges key information such as the intensity, distance, and movement direction of lightning activities. Once it detects that the lightning threat reaches the warning level, the system quickly triggers the warning release module.
The warning release module notifies relevant personnel in the coal mine through multiple channels. It displays alarm information on screens at key locations such as the dispatch room, offices, and wellheads. The system also transmits warning messages to every miner and staff member via broadcasting, text messages, acoustic-optic alarms, etc., enabling them to take timely measures (e.g., stopping outdoor operations, evacuating hazardous areas, turning off power for critical equipment) to minimize the hazards of lightning to the coal mine and ensure safe production and personnel safety.
